Install Guarda Wallet Extension Login Connect Dapps and Recovery Steps

Begin by adding the Guarda interface to your browser. This step establishes a direct gateway for managing various cryptocurrencies and tokens directly from your preferred web browser, eliminating the need for separate desktop applications.


Accessing your funds requires establishing a new vault. You will define a robust password and securely archive the provided 12-word mnemonic phrase. This phrase is the absolute master key; its loss is irreversible. Store it physically, offline, and never in digital form.


Once your vault is active, linking to decentralized applications is straightforward. Visit a supported dApp platform and select the option to link a browser-based vault. Authorize the connection when prompted; this creates a secure channel for transactions without exposing your private keys.


Should you need to regain entry on a new device, the process relies entirely on your secret phrase. Initiate the vault restoration procedure and input your 12 words in the exact sequence. This action rebuilds your entire portfolio, including all associated addresses and transaction history, proving the critical nature of that phrase's preservation.

Installing the Guarda Browser Extension Step-by-Step

Navigate directly to the official Chrome Web Store or Firefox Add-ons portal using your preferred internet navigator.


Locate the software by searching for its specific name. Verify the publisher details match the official development team before proceeding.


Click the "Add to Browser" button. A confirmation dialog will appear; accept it to initiate the addition process. The utility will automatically integrate into your toolbar upon completion.


Find the new icon near your address bar and select it to launch the interface for the first time. You'll be presented with a clear choice: generate a brand new vault or restore an existing one using your secret phrase.


If creating a new vault, carefully record the 12 to 24-word mnemonic phrase displayed on-screen. Write it on paper and store it physically. This phrase is the sole key to your funds if you switch devices.


Confirm your backup by accurately re-entering the words in the exact sequence shown. This critical step ensures you have properly saved the access credentials.


Establish a strong local password. This encrypts the vault's data on your current machine, preventing unauthorized access from this specific workstation.


Your self-custody interface is now active. You can inspect asset balances, manage holdings, and authorize transactions with decentralized applications by selecting the plugin icon when visiting supported web services.

How to Log In and Secure Your Extension Wallet

Access your vault directly from your browser's toolbar after adding it; a single click on its icon typically opens the interface.


You will be prompted for your secret phrase or a strong, locally-stored password you created during the initial setup. Never enter these credentials on any website other than the vault's own pop-up interface.


Immediately activate the two-factor authentication feature within the application's security settings, linking it to an authenticator app like Authy or Google Authenticator for a critical secondary check on every access attempt.


Bookmark the official website of the software provider and only interact with your asset manager through that saved link to avoid sophisticated phishing sites that mimic the login screen.


For interacting with decentralized applications, manually review and limit transaction permissions–such as token spending allowances–each time instead of granting indefinite access. Revoke these permissions in your vault's settings after your session concludes.


A hardware-based storage solution provides the strongest defense, as your private keys remain on the physical device during transactions, making them inaccessible to online threats even if your browser is compromised.


Regularly clear your browser cache and ensure your operating system and the vault software itself are updated to their latest versions to patch potential security vulnerabilities.

I installed the Guarda extension, but I can't see my old wallet. Did I lose everything?

Not necessarily. The extension itself is a fresh interface. Your assets are stored on the blockchain, not inside the extension. To see your old wallet, you need to recover it within the new extension. Click "Access Wallet" and then select "Restore from backup." You will need your recovery phrase (the 12 or 24-word seed phrase you saved when you created the original wallet). Entering this phrase will restore your wallet's access within the extension, showing all your previous transactions and balances.

Is it safe to connect the Guarda wallet to any DApp I find?

No, you must be cautious. Connecting your wallet grants a DApp permissions, often to view your wallet address and request transactions. Only connect to DApps you trust. Before connecting, research the DApp's reputation. When you connect, Guarda will show a permission request—check what the DApp is asking for. Be extremely wary of sites that immediately prompt for your recovery phrase; a legitimate DApp will never ask for it. If you're unsure, use a separate, small-balance wallet for testing new DApps.

What's the exact difference between logging in and connecting the wallet?

Logging in refers to accessing your wallet's interface within the Guarda extension itself, typically using a password you set for the extension. This lets you view balances and prepare transactions. Connecting, often called "WalletConnect," is an action you take on a decentralized application (DApp) website. When you click "Connect Wallet" on a DApp, it establishes a secure link so the DApp can request actions (like signing a swap) from your already-unlocked Guarda wallet. You must be logged in to your wallet before you can approve a connection request from a DApp.

I lost my recovery phrase. Can I get my funds back using my Guarda extension password?

No, you cannot. The password you set for the Guarda extension only protects access to that specific browser installation. It does not generate your recovery phrase. Your recovery phrase is the master key to your cryptocurrency on the blockchain. If you lose it and then uninstall the extension or lose the device, there is no way to regain access using just the extension password. Guarda Wallet first time setup does not store your phrase. Your only option is to find your written backup. If it's truly lost, the funds are permanently inaccessible.
